Transaction ca8c45552f353298047334a2a0c76705c03a868db8a7ccdc0d5ea5a0fcde92ff

block
06dabc045d878a6a9fdb04bb8f1198ce14efefc6253b008f0c169d27af6e0156

1 Input

23 Outputs